AMOLED, stands for Active Matrix Organic Light Emitting Diode, is a variant of OLED technology. Just like OLEDs, AMOLEDs use organic materials to produce light. However, AMOLED displays include an additional layer of thin-film transistors (TFTs) that control the charge of each pixel, making them more energy efficient.

The display's contrast is measured as the difference between the darkest and brightest points, and in an OLED display, this difference can be virtually infinite as the brightness level can go down to 0 nits when displaying true black.

A significant advantage of OLED technology is its power efficiency. As OLEDs can produce their own light, they typically consume less power compared to mainstream LCD display panels. However, OLEDs also have their share of disadvantages, with the most prominent ones being susceptibility to burn-in and degradation over time due to the organic materials used by the smartphone manufacturers.

The primary difference between OLED and AMOLED displays lies in the technology used. While OLED uses organic materials to emit light, AMOLED adds an active matrix layer that controls the current flowing through each pixel. This active matrix layer makes AMOLED displays more energy-efficient and versatile, resulting in brighter displays and more vibrant colours.

Visible light or the visible spectrum is the region of the electromagnetic spectrum that can be perceived by the human eye and corresponds to wavelengths between 380 and 750 nanometres.

When it comes to power consumption, AMOLED displays have a clear edge over OLED displays. Thanks to their active matrix layer and storage capacitors, AMOLED displays are capable of maintaining pixel states and using power more efficiently. This makes AMOLED displays a more suitable choice for battery-powered devices such as smartphones and tablets.
